(1)
host
核心需要支援
tap/tun, lsmod | grep tun
看支不支援。
(2)啟動並在
host
生成乙個虛擬網絡卡
tap0
sudo qemu -m pc -m 1024 -net nic-net tap,ifname=tap0,script=/etc/qemu-ifupdebian.1.img
(3)host:
ifconfig tapn 192.168.25.1 netmask255.255.255.0
guest:
ifconfig eth0 192.168.25.123 netmask255.255.255.0
route add default gw 192.168.25.1
現在即為
host-only
模式,即只可以
ping
通host
(4)設定
nat
這個其實就是在
host
裡雙網絡卡,其中
eth0
為tapn
做nat。
首先開啟
ip轉換功能(也可以直接編輯配置檔案
ip_forward=1)
echo 1>/proc/sys/net/ipv4/ip_forward
然後開啟nat
iptables -t nat -a postrouting -oeth0 -s 192.168.25.0/24 -j masquerade
上句的意思為將所有來自192.168.8.0/24網段的資料報,從eth0介面**出去
參考:qemu設定網路**)
debian8 安裝後的設定
去掉預設的源從 安裝 nano etc apt sources.list 注釋掉 deb cdrom debian gnu linux 8.3.0 jessie official i386 binary 1 20160123 18 03 jessie contrib main apt get ins...
debian8 安裝後的設定
去掉預設的源從 安裝 nano etc apt sources.list 注釋掉 deb cdrom debian gnu linux 8.3.0 jessie official i386 binary 1 20160123 18 03 jessie contrib main apt get ins...
解決Debian安裝後中文亂碼
最近在vmbox安裝了debian7.10,選擇中文安裝,安裝後出現亂碼 解決方法如下 首先進入系統,開啟終端 注意,終端因為亂碼的原因不好找到 su 切換到超級使用者許可權 編輯locale檔案 值得注意的是,vi編輯器不太好用,在修改檔案的過程中需要先探索一下vi的基本使用 vi etc def...